Snow Patrol have announced their return with a brand new album and arena tour, which includes two dates in Dublin and Belfast next year. Titled The Forest Is The Path, the new album is the Northern Irish band’s first in six years and is set for release on September 13. The promote the upcoming LP, Snow Patrol have announced details of an eight date UK & Ireland Arena tour in February 2025.
